Astrophysicist proposes a new theory of gravity without a conservation law about study Non-conserved modified gravity theory (PDF)

A RUDN astrophysicist Hamidreza Fazlollahi has built a new theory of gravity, in which the "law of conservation" of the energy–momentum tensor is not required. He started from the so-called Gibbs–Duhem relation. This is an equation that shows how the indicators of its components change in a thermodynamic system. After the transformations, we have an equation that resembles the classical Einstein equation in form, but with different factors and constants. The field equations were supplemented with two terms. One describes temperature–entropy, and the second describes charge and interaction.

The astrophysicist showed that the new gravitational model is consistent for different environments and can be used in astrophysical and astronomical research. As an example, the author tested the new theory by calculating two stages of the development of the universe—inflationary and accelerating expansion. The new theory's indications are consistent with experimental observations. See also:
